Sausage Diavolo Pizza

You can never have too many main course recipes, so give Sausage Diavolo Pizzan a try. This recipe covers 28%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. This recipe serves 5. One portion of this dish contains approximately 35g of protein, 52g of fat, and a total of 841 calories. This recipe is typical of Mediterranean cuisine. A mixture of extra virgin olive oil, cherry tomatoes, pepper flakes, and a handful of other ingredients are all it takes to make this recipe so flavorful.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es roughly 45 minutes.

Instructions

1
Position oven rack to center and preheat to 450 degrees F. Lightly oil a pizza pan and roll out crust, thin.

2
In a large skillet, heat oil and saute sausage and red pepper flakes until browned.

3
Remove from heat, drain fat, cool slightly and chop.
4
Add garlic and onion to skillet and cook about five minutes until onion is soft.

5
Add cherry tomatoes, canned tomatoes, wine and oregano.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

6
Let simmer about 20 minutes, stirring when necessary, until cherry tomatoes are soft and sauce thickens.

7
Add parsley and sausage back into skillet.

8
Remove from heat.
9
Top pizza crust with sausage mixture, grated cheeses and red pepper slices.

10
Bake 8-10 minutes.

11
Remove from oven, sprinkle with fresh herbs, cut and enjoy!

Recommended wine: Chianti, Trebbiano, Verdicchio

Italian on the menu? Try pairing with Chianti, Trebbiano, and Verdicchio. Italians know food and they know wine. Trebbiano and Verdicchio are Italian white wines that pair well with fish and white meat, while Chianti is a great Italian red for heavier, bolder dishes.
